According to http://www.newdream.org/, people in America spend lots of money disposing of unwanted paper waste. Americans use "more than 100 million trees' worth of bulk mail" and we could fill "450,000 garbage trucks" with this paper waste. Most of this waste is not recycled and is disposed of using taxpayers dollars. California spent "$500,000" per year disposing of those disks for free internet service. This website proposes to rid America of this waste by recycling and telling these bulk mailers that we no longer want their trash. We would all send a clear message if we would write to these various junk mailers and tell them that we want them to stop killing trees and using them to fill our mailboxes with useless trash.
